What is Sonos Scaled Net Operating Assets?

Sonos FRA:8SO -0.69% 61 Scaled Net Operating Assets is 0.21 as of Mar. 2026. GuruFocus rates FRA:8SO with a GF Score™ of 61/100 and a GF Value™ of €12.50 (Fairly Valued). The stock has 2 warning signs investors should review.

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) is calculated as the difference between operating assets and operating liabilities, scaled by lagged total assets.

Sonos's operating assets for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was €511 Mil. Sonos's operating liabilities for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was €343 Mil. Sonos's Total Assets for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was €809 Mil. Therefore, Sonos's scaled net operating assets (SNOA) for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was 0.21.

Sonos Scaled Net Operating Assets Calculation

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) is calculated as the difference between operating assets and operating liabilities, scaled by lagged total assets.

Sonos's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) for the fiscal year that ended in Sep. 2025 is calculated as

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A)(A: Sep. 2025 )
=(Operating Assets (A: Sep. 2025 )-Operating Liabilities (A: Sep. 2025 ))/Total Assets (A: Sep. 2024 )
=(507.581-347.983)/825.597
=0.19

where

Operating Assets(A: Sep. 2025 )
=Total Assets -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ities
=701.433 - 193.852
=507.581

Operating Liabilities(A: Sep. 2025 )
=Total Liabilities -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ation -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ation
=398.781 - 45.401 - 5.397
=347.983

Sonos's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A)(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=(Operating Assets (Q: Mar. 2026 )-Operating Liabilities (Q: Mar. 2026 ))/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=(510.721-342.917)/809.485
=0.21

where

Operating Assets(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=Total Assets -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ities
=726.152 - 215.431
=510.721

Operating Liabilities(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=Total Liabilities -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ation -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ation
=393.678 - 44.81 - 5.951
=342.917

Sonos Business Description

Other Exchanges SONO:USA0ZFN:UK8SO:Germany
Address 301 Coromar Drive, Santa Barbara, CA, USA, 93117
Sonos Inc is an audio company dedicated to elevating life through sound, offering a connected platform that brings together music, movies, stories, and conversations. Its portfolio includes home theater speakers, components, plug-in and portable speakers and headphones, known for exceptional sound, thoughtful design, ease of use and seamless access to audio content. Its partner products and other revenue categories include accessories for home integration, such as custom-designed stands, mounts, and shelving units, along with partnerships for architectural speakers and automotive sound systems, as well as licensing, advertising revenue, and subscription-based services. The company operates in the United States and other countries, with the majority of revenue coming from the United States.
